Defensive Inconsistencies
One of the primary concerns surrounding Argentina is their defensive stability. Throughout the tournament, their backline has shown moments of vulnerability, often leaving gaps that quick attackers can exploit. Friedel pointed out that while Argentina possesses individual talent, their teamwork in defense has at times lacked cohesion. This could be a significant liability against England's pacey forward line, which includes players like Harry Kane and Raheem Sterling, both known for capitalizing on defensive errors.
Midfield Control
Argentina's midfield will be critical in this matchup. The ability to maintain possession and dictate the game's tempo is essential for thwarting England's offensive strategies. Friedel emphasized that if Argentina's midfield fails to control the flow, they risk being overrun. Players like Rodrigo De Paul and Leandro Paredes must rise to the occasion and provide both defensive cover and creative output to support their forwards.
Impact of Injuries
Injuries to key players can derail any team's momentum, and Argentina is no exception. The doubts over the fitness of several squad members could hamper their tactical flexibility and depth. If top players cannot perform, coach Lionel Scaloni may be forced to make tough choices that could affect team chemistry. Friedel notes that the ability to adapt to such challenges will be essential for Argentina's success in the upcoming match.
